COMMERCIAL.

Following was the revenue received at the Custom-house last week: Customs duties £917 os, beer duty £46 Is 6d, light dues £7 12s 7d, Harbor Board revenue £73 6s Bd, other receipts £5 ; total, £1049 5s 9d. Messrs Malcolm and Co. report large entries of poultry and produce at their mart on Saturday. The following prices were realised!:—Turkeys Ssi, fowls Is 5d to 2s 2d, ducks Is -9d to 2s, hens and chiclts 4s 6d, eggs Is 2d to Is 4d, butter lOd to lid, plums 3d per lb, new potatoes 2d per lb, cauliflowers 2s 3d per dozen, peas lOd, cabbages Is 9d per dozen' bananas 8s to 12s per case, odd. potatoes os to 6s per sack, small apples 3s per case. The firm also report that they will liofld a Christmas sale of produce, fruit, poultry, and fancy goods on Tuesday next, starting lat 11 o’clock; also 5 tons of table potatoes at the same time, without any reserve.

At the Lowe street Horse Bazaar on Saturday afternoon, there was a large attendance, but the demand was poor, and .a. good number were passed in. Heavy horses sold well from £l2 to £lB, hacks, good sorts £8 to £l2; poor sorts, 30s to £7 10s.
